Why it stands out
The 2025 Toyota RAV4 stands out because it combines the qualities that made the nameplate so influential in the first place with the practical strengths buyers still want today. Toyota’s buying guide describes the RAV4 as the template for the modern small crossover SUV, and that reputation is backed up by its long-running appeal as a family hauler that remains a compelling, responsible choice. It is also known for being highly practical rather than especially exciting, with a plain interior and a focus on usefulness over flash.
For this generation, the RAV4’s appeal comes from its broad range of configurations and its mix of efficiency, capability, and value. Toyota has updated it in recent years with efficient hybrid and plug-in hybrid powertrains that deliver surprising performance while maintaining solid fuel economy, and the lineup also includes rugged-oriented versions with decent trail capability. The SUV comes standard with a full suite of advanced driver aids, and Toyota has kept pricing reasonable despite the amount of equipment on offer. That makes the RAV4 especially attractive to shoppers who want a well-equipped crossover that is easy to live with and likely to stay affordable over time.
There are tradeoffs, though, and they help define the RAV4’s character. The guide notes that its engines are not usually the most powerful in the class, that it was not especially engaging to drive until recently, and that its cabin is usually a sea of gray plastic. Even so, its strong reliability reputation and low-hassle ownership experience are major reasons it continues to be such a popular choice.

Pricing Analysis by Model Year
Key Insights
- Significant Premium for New Models: The 2026 Toyota RAV4 is priced at $45,428, reflecting a 42.5% increase over its MSRP, indicating strong demand for the latest model.
- Depreciation Trends: Older models, such as the 2018 RAV4, show a steep decline in value, priced at $19,013, which is -22.3% compared to its original MSRP.
- Best Value Years: The 2022 model is priced at $28,323, only -2.4% below its MSRP, making it a compelling option for buyers looking for recent models with minimal depreciation.
Model Year Pricing
| Model Year | Original MSRP | Avg Price | Price vs MSRP |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 Toyota RAV4 | $31,900 | $45,428 | +42.5% |
| 2024 Toyota RAV4 | $28,675 | $31,527 | +9.9% |
| 2023 Toyota RAV4 | $28,275 | $30,651 | +8.4% |
| 2022 Toyota RAV4 | $26,975 | $28,323 | -2.4% |
| 2021 Toyota RAV4 | $26,350 | $25,752 | -2.3% |
| 2020 Toyota RAV4 | $25,950 | $24,055 | -7.3% |
| 2019 Toyota RAV4 | $25,650 | $22,996 | -10.3% |
| 2018 Toyota RAV4 | $24,660 | $19,013 | -22.3% |
| 2017 Toyota RAV4 | $24,410 | $18,965 | -22.4% |
| 2016 Toyota RAV4 | $24,350 | $16,473 | -32.4% |
| 2015 Toyota RAV4 | $23,680 | $15,009 | -36.8% |
| 2014 Toyota RAV4 | $23,550 | $14,096 | -40.1% |

What should I look for when buying a used 2025 Toyota RAV4?
Accident-free inventory is excellent at 91.8% — clean inventory, standard diligence applies.
You should still run a vehicle history report and confirm the car’s service records before you commit. Prioritize a pre-purchase inspection if the listing shows high mileage, uneven tire wear, or signs of hard use. Focus your condition check on the cabin, suspension, brakes, and any features you expect to rely on every day.
